The Sabine County Reporter December 18, 1996, Page 10 Homer Murray Homer Murray, 73, of San Augustine died Friday, Dec. 6, 1996, at his residence. Born Jan. 27, 1923, in Chireno, he had been a longtime resident of San Augustine and was a retired manager for Deep East Texas Electric Coop. Murray was a U. S. Army veteran and a member of First Baptist Church. Survivors: wife, Blanche Murray of San Augustine; daughters, Peggy Hardy of San Augustine, Gail Fuller of Rosevine, Nancy Stiles of Lake Jackson, and Kathy Boyd of Hawkins, brothers, Haskell Murray of Chireno and Haze Murray of Diboll; mother-in-law, Ellie Woods of San Augustine; and ten grandchildren. Funeral services were held at 2 p.m. Sundant at First Baptist Church, San Augustine. Interment followed at Liberty Hill Cemetery. (Funeral Home records indicate Liberty Hill Memorial Garden) Arrangementw were handled by Wyman Roberts Funeral Chapel in San Augustine. (Transcribed by Melinda McLemore Strong, February 2011) ------------------------------------ From french association "New Jersey Cavalry - Section Française", WW2 Veteran : - ENLIST : Nov. 4th, 1943, Tyler (TX) - ASN : 38 48 2015 - RANK : Private First Class - UNIT : 117th Cav. Rec. Sqdn. (Mecz). - COMPANY : F – 1st Platoon - MORE : Assistant Driver.
